Town defender David Wright is hoping his team mates will club together and pay he fine he is going to get for being booked today.

Wright was booked for celebrating his goal against Norwich and ending up in the crowd, which he blames on his team mates so he is hoping they will pay the fine for him.

 

Wright: “It was my first taste of a derby match down here and to score was a fantastic feeling, especially in front of our fans, I don't get many goals so they are all special, but perhaps this one was extra special and I ended up celebrating in with the fans.

 

“The referee booked me for it but I am going to ask the lads to pay the fine because it was only when they all piled on top of me that I ended up in falling into the crowd!”
